Title :
An Automatic Software Decentralization Framework for Distributed Device Collaboration
Author :
Iwasaki, Yohei ; Kawaguchi, Nobuo
Author_Institution :
Nagoya Univ., Nagoya
Abstract :
Recently, many low-profile devices with RF communication features have been developed such as sensor network nodes and one-chip microcomputers. This caused a variety of gadgets join to the wireless network. However, in order to realize collaborations between these devices, generally we have to develop complicated distributed software. In this paper, we propose an automatic software decentralization method, which converts a stand-alone software program into distributed software programs. In order to execute the generated software on these low-profile devices, we employ the programming language nesC for a decentralization target. We also have implemented applications with real hardware devices to exemplify that the proposed method successfully improves the ease of development.
Keywords :
distributed processing; groupware; programming languages; RF communication feature; automatic software decentralization method; distributed device collaboration; nesC programming language; stand-alone software program; wireless network; Application software; Batteries; Centralized control; Collaboration; Collaborative software; Collaborative work; Communication system control; Control systems; Protocols; Temperature sensors;
Conference_Titel :
Distributed Computing Systems Workshops, 2007. ICDCSW '07. 27th International Conference on
Conference_Location :
Toronto, Ont.
Print_ISBN :
0-7695-2838-4
Electronic_ISBN :
1545-0678
DOI :
10.1109/ICDCSW.2007.20